MatlabCode

本站所有资源均为高质量资源,各种姿势下载。

您现在的位置是:MatlabCode > 资源下载 > 一般算法 > 算法合集

算法合集

资 源 简 介

算法合集

详 情 说 明

算法是计算机科学的核心基础,它描述了解决问题的明确步骤。高效的算法可以显著提升程序性能,特别是在处理大规模数据时。

常见算法主要分为以下几类:

排序算法 排序算法将数据按照特定顺序排列。典型算法包括快速排序、归并排序和冒泡排序等,每种算法在不同场景下各有优劣。

搜索算法 搜索算法用于在数据集合中查找特定元素。二分查找是经典算法,要求数据预先排序,能在对数时间内完成搜索。

图算法 图算法处理节点和边的网络结构。深度优先搜索(DFS)和广度优先搜索(BFS)是基础遍历方法,Dijkstra算法解决最短路径问题。

动态规划 动态规划通过分解子问题来优化计算,避免重复运算。适用于具有最优子结构特性的问题,如背包问题或斐波那契数列计算。